Did you know that 11 deaf men made an important contribution that made travel to space possible?! The Gallaudet Eleven were a group of deaf men recruited by NASA in the late 1950s to study how the human body handles motion and disorientation in space. Because they had inner ear conditions that made them less sensitive to motion sickness, they performed exceptionally well in spinning chair and balance tests. Their unique resistance to dizziness provided valuable insights into how astronauts might cope with the extreme conditions of space travel. This research helped scientists better understand spatial orientation and contributed to preparing astronauts for future missions like the Apollo 11!
